    Job Summary

    As a Planning & Entitlements Manager, you manage land planning, entitlements, and approvals for new and existing land assets. The Planning & Entitlements Manager works with divisions and numerous internal departments to ensure that our communities are designed and developed within our standards. The most rewarding part of this role is playing an integral role in the planning of communities that provide homes for so many.

    Your skills will be used to:

  • Manage, mentor, and train Land Planners for growth within The Fischer Group.
  • Develop entitlement and approval strategies and represent the company in public and private meetings regarding annexation, rezoning, and preliminary development plan approvals.
  • Identify due diligence issues related to potential land acquisitions and manage various consultants through the approval and entitlement process.
  • Understand various land purchase and financing structures to recommend acquisition strategies, balance risk, and increase profitability.
  • Coordinate and collaborate with various positions throughout The Fischer Group to determine the feasibility/desirability of a land prospect, including evaluating the marketability, best use, development cost, degree of engineering difficulty, governmental approval process, time frame, and the likelihood of obtaining approval.
  • Partner with internal teams and external consultants to ensure the integration of planning and design elements.
  • Assist in the review and preparation of site plans for entry monuments, amenity centers, playgrounds, and trail systems.
  • Work with municipal staff and stakeholders to determine the feasibility of a parcel of land including marketability, best use, development costs, and value engineering.
  • Establish annexation, rezoning, and preliminary/final development plan approval schedules and timelines.
  • Work with Internal Land Acquisition teams to explore and secure public financing options to improve financial viability.
  • Assist Vice Presidents in negotiating and documenting public financing options and agreements through the approval process.
